1. Standard way through phone settings
The most obvious method is to use the built-in MIUI tools, which is suitable for most users who don't want to go into technical details.
- Open the Settings app (cog icon).
- Go to the section Sound and vibration.
- Slap on the call melody item.
- Choose one of the suggested tunes or click Local tunes if you want to use yours.
If the list does not contain a suitable ringtone, the system will offer to download additional ones via the Mi Sound Store. note that this will require an active Internet connection. Also note that some tunes may be blocked due to regional restrictions (for example, in firmware for India or China).

2. Use of the Music app to install the ringtone
Few people know, but the built-in Mi Music player allows you to assign tracks as ringtones, which is a convenient method if you want to use a snippet of a song from your library.
- ๐ต Open the Music app and find the track you want to make a ringtone.
- ๐ฑ Slip along the track and select More (three dots in the upper right corner).
- ๐ In the menu, click Set as a ringtone.
- โ Confirm the selection โ the melody will automatically appear in the list of standard ringtones.
MIUI trims tracks longer than 30 seconds. If you want a particular snippet, pre-cut it in any audio editor (for example, MP3 Cutter from Google Play). Also note that not all formats are supported: the best option is.mp3 or.m4a with a bit rate of no more than 320 kbps.

3. Manual Rington Loading Through File System
For advanced users who want full control of the tunes, the method of placing files in system folders is suitable, this is especially true if you downloaded the ringtone from the Internet or created it yourself.
Here's the step-by-step instruction:
- Connect Redmi 9 to your computer or use a file manager (such as Mi File Explorer or Solid Explorer).
- Go to /storage/emulated/0/MIUI/ringtone, if you don't have one, create it manually.
- Put your audio file (.mp3,.ogg or.m4a) there.
- Reset the device.
- Go to Settings โ Sounds and Vibrations โ Call Melody โ Local Melodies โ your file should appear in the list.
| File format | Max size. | Support for MIUI | Notes |
|---|---|---|---|
| .mp3 | 5 MB | Yes. | The best choice |
| .m4a | 10 MB | Yes. | Best quality at the same size |
| .ogg | 3 MB | Partially. | It may not be displayed in MIUI 12. |
| .wav | 1 MB | No. | Not recommended |

4. Installation of ringtones through third-party applications
If you don't like the built-in MIUI tools, you can use third-party utilities.
- ๐ผ Zedge โ a huge library of ringtones and notifications with the ability to pre-listen.
- ๐ Ringtone Maker โ allows you to crop tracks and set them as ringtones or alarm clocks.
- ๐ฑ MP3 Cutter and Ringtone Maker โ advanced editor with support for fades and sound normalization.
Example of installation via Zedge:
- Install the app from Google Play.
- Find your favorite ringtone and click Download.
- After downloading, tap Set as ringtone.
- Select Phone ringtone (calling melody) or Notification sound (notification sound).
Third-party apps have the advantage of accessing millions of tunes and fine-tuning them, but beware: some programs ask for unnecessary permissions (such as access to contacts or SMS) before installing them, check reviews and ratings in the Play Market.

5. Advanced Method: Using ADB (for power users)
If none of the above methods worked (for example, due to custom firmware or MIUI limitations), you can resort to Android Debug Bridge (ADB), which requires connecting the phone to a computer and basic command line knowledge.
Instructions:
- Enable USB debugging in the developer settings (Settings โ About Phone โ MIUI version โ tap 7 times, then go back to Additional โ For Developers).
- Connect Redmi 9 to your PC and confirm debugging permission.
- Download ADB Tools and unpack it into a separate folder.
- Place your ringtone (for example, my_ringtone.mp3) into the platform-tools folder.
- Open the command line in this folder and do: adb push my_ringtone.mp3 /sdcard/MIUI/ringtone/ adb shell am broadcast -a android.intent.action.MEDIA_SCANNER_SCAN_FILE -d file:///sdcard/MIUI/ringtone/my_ringtone.mp3
- Reboot the phone.
This method is guaranteed to work even on locked firmware, where system folders are not available for writing through the file manager. However, it requires caution: the wrong ADB commands can cause system failures. If you are not sure about your actions, you better turn to other methods.

6 Problem Solving: Why doesn't the ringtone change?
Sometimes, even after all the manipulations, the ringtone remains the same, and let's look at the typical causes and ways to eliminate them:
- ๐ Media Cash: Clear the Cache in Settings โ Annexes โ Music. โ Memory. โ Clear the cache.
- ๐ Incorrect folder: Make sure the file is in the /MIUI/ringtone, not /Ringtones (This folder is ignored in MIUI).
- ๐ Firmware limitations: On some versions MIUI (For example, Chinese ringtone change blocked, so the solution is to change the firmware region or use the ringtone. ADB.
- ๐ต Application conflict: If third-party launchers (like Nova Launcher) are installed, they can intercept audio settings.
If the problem persists, check whether Do Not Disturb or No Sound is activated in the notification curtain, and make sure the ringtone file is not corrupted โ try playing it in any player.
